Course Content

• Advanced Microscopy Techniques for Nanomaterials Characterization (including TEM, SEM, AFM)
• X-ray Diffraction and Scattering Methods for Nanostructure Analysis (XRD, SAXS, WAXS)
• Spectroscopic Techniques in Nanomaterials Analysis (Raman, XPS, UV-Vis)
• Thermal Analysis of Nanomaterials (TGA, DSC)
• Surface Area and Porosity Characterization of Nanomaterials (BET, physisorption)
• Nanomaterials Synthesis and Processing: relevance to characterization
• Data Analysis and Interpretation in Nanomaterials Characterization
• Practical Applications of Nanomaterials Characterization (e.g., in energy, medicine, electronics)
